Thanks guys.

The Arietta sounds very good with Darth Beyers IMO, as do all Meier amps. I cannot answer questions like "worthwhile" differences though, because what is meaningful to me is not the same as what is meaningful to everyone else. The Arietta and Cantate both have crossfeed (all Meier amps do). I use Meier crossfeed - I like it.

I hope to formally compare the Cantate and the Lisa III soon.
